Apophis, also known as 99942 Apophis, is a near-Earth asteroid that astronomers have been tracking since its discovery in 2004:

Size 

Apophis is estimated to be about 1,100 feet (335 meters) across

Origin 

Apophis is a remnant from the early solar system, formed around 4.6 billion years ago in the asteroid belt between Mars and Jupiter

Name 

Apophis is named after the Egyptian god of chaos and destruction, reflecting the potential danger posed by its impact

Orbit 

Apophis’s orbit was initially poorly understood, and it was initially thought to have a small chance of impacting Earth in 2029, 2036, or 2068

Current status 

Radar observations in March 2021, combined with precise orbit analysis, have shown that Apophis will not impact Earth for at least 100 years

2029 flyby 

In 2029, Apophis will pass as close as 30,600 kilometers (19,000 miles) above Earth, closer than our geostationary communications satellites. This flyby will provide a unique opportunity for scientific study and public outreach

There are a number of ways to prevent an asteroid from hitting Earth, including

Gravity tractor 

A spacecraft is placed in orbit around an asteroid and uses its gravity to slowly change the asteroid’s trajectory. This technique works best if there are months or years of warning, and it might not work for asteroids larger than 1,640 feet in diameter. 

Kinetic impactor 

A spacecraft is slammed into the asteroid to change its momentum

Laser ablation 

A laser vaporizes rock on the asteroid’s surface, creating jets that push it away

Nuclear weapon 

A nuclear bomb is detonated a few hundred feet away from the asteroid to rip away its surface and push it off course. This is a last resort option that’s only feasible if the asteroid is spotted at the last minute

Early detection is critical to preventing an asteroid impact. NASA conducts tabletop exercises to assess Earth’s ability to respond to asteroid threats

An object with a high mass close to the Earth could be sent out into a collision course with the asteroid, knocking it off course. When the asteroid is still far from the Earth, a means of deflecting the asteroid is to directly alter its momentum by colliding a spacecraft with the asteroid
